This tungsten basket heater must be operated within its rated electrical limits and used only in vacuum evaporation systems. Physical handling requires care to avoid mechanical damage to the brittle tungsten wire structure.
- Electrical Limit: Operate the heater at or below 3.22 V, 37 A, and 119 W to prevent thermal runaway or wire failure.
- Temperature Limit: Do not exceed 1800 °C to avoid material degradation or melting of the tungsten basket.
- Vacuum Environment: Use only in vacuum evaporation systems; atmospheric operation may cause damage to the heater.
- Mechanical Handling: Handle the basket by the base only to avoid bending or breaking the tungsten coils.
- Fit Verification: Confirm the basket dimensions (1.25 in H x 3/8 in W x 1/4 in ID) match the source holder before installation.
